Output 653a103752f6ae02558959e36a7b169e62058f96b13aae7855b59501a0b0e850:2

value
53816423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e5885ade99f0f296b1f9d8099d68e436629ad8e OP_EQUAL
address
MHxccAH6CGuzUHQqAj9rxMv9n1ddCmXLLM
transaction
653a103752f6ae02558959e36a7b169e62058f96b13aae7855b59501a0b0e850
spent
true